When in Rome, do as the Romans do[1] (Medieval Latin s fuers Rmae, Rmn vvit mre; s fuers alib, vvit scut ib; often shortened to when in Rome),[2] or a later version when in Rome, do as the Pope does,[3] is a proverb attributed to Saint Ambrose. The Story behind It: When St. Augustine arrived in Milan, he observed that the Church did not fast on Saturday as did the Church at Rome.
